How much do account services associ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 21, 2026, the average hourly pay for account services associate in Oregon is $23.34,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$22.36 and $26.44 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does an Account Services Associate typically collaborate with other departments to support client needs?

As an Account Services Associate, you'll frequently work with teams such as sales, marketing, and customer support to ensure client requests are addressed efficiently. You may coordinate with the sales team to clarify client requirements, relay feedback to product or service teams, and work with billing or finance for account-related inquiries. Effective communication and organization are key, as you'll often act as a liaison to help resolve issues and ensure a seamless client experience. This collaborative environment helps you build a broad understanding of company operations while contributing directly to client satisfaction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Account Services Associ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Account Services Associate, you need strong customer service skills, attention to detail, and a background in business or communications, often supported by a relevant degree. Familiarity with CRM software, Microsoft Office Suite, and sometimes industry-specific platforms is typically required. Excellent interpersonal skills, problem-solving abilities, and the capacity to manage multiple tasks efficiently help professionals stand out in this role. These skills ensure effective client support, accurate account management, and contribute to overall customer satisfaction and retention.

What does an Account Services Associate do?

An Account Services Associate typically supports client accounts within a company, assisting with tasks such as managing client inquiries, processing account requests, maintaining accurate records, and coordinating with internal teams to ensure client satisfaction. They play a key role in resolving issues, updating account information, and facilitating communication between clients and the business. This position often requires strong organizational, communication, and problem-solving skills to meet client needs efficiently.

Job description

The Account Manager's primary objective is to provide Transportation Insight's clients with world-class analytical and relationship management by filling the role of a long-term logistics expert/consultant.

An Account Manager will be a key component in matching the client's needs to Transportation Insight's products and services to provide efficiencies and continuous improvement. Account Managers may also have direct account management responsibilities for smaller or less complex clients.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Review and analyze client data weekly for trends, issues and additional opportunities for freight cost savings.
  • Review open client requests. Check status and ensure progress towards request closure and client satisfaction. Review carrier performance, as well as, an assigned client's satisfaction with carrier performance.
  • Interdepartmental Communication at all levels both internally & externally for process improvements & client requests.
  • Conduct monthly client reviews. Review company tools and services available to assigned clients.
  • The document which tools are being utilized, the client's satisfaction with the tools and demonstrate newer tools that the client may not be utilizing, where applicable.
  • Attempt to engage the client on new services (organic revenue growth) and/or offer additional cost savings opportunities through cost analysis, if applicable.
  • Create case studies highlighting the client's use of Transportation Insight's products/services for marketing and retention purposes.
  • Cost minimization: Review opportunities for an assigned client to transition to more cost attractive solutions, as well as, investigate additional ways in which a client may reduce their operational cost (while maintaining an equivalent or higher level of service).
  • Provide training and direction to Logistics Analyst personnel
